To apply Serigraphy effects
1 To apply the effect to:
• The canvas — Click the Canvas in the Layers panel.
• A selection — Click a selection tool from the toolbox, and drag in the document window to select an
area.
• A layer — Click a layer in the Layers panel.
2
Choose Effects Surface Control Serigraphy.
3 Click the Match to color chip, and choose a color from the Color dialog box.
This is the center color — the color on which the effect will be based.
4 Click the Fill with color chip, and choose a color from the Color dialog box.
This color is used on the new layer.
5 In the Serigraphy color dialog box, adjust any of the following sliders:
• Smoothing — determines the smoothness of the black edge
• Threshold — determines the total amount of color difference from the center color
• Distance Weighting — determines the amount of color distance from the center color
• Hue Weighting — determines how much hue contributes to the effect
• Sat Weighting — determines how much saturation contributes to the effect
• Lum Weighting — determines how much luminance contributes to the effect
6 Click Create Serigraphy Layer.
7 Click OK.
You can also specify Match and Fill colors by clicking a color in the image.
